Output 87e343030cfe7dc083e73ef80c2b1e44a33befccbcc4a124e1fd789fc119f459:0

value
404000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5445dd4e35a7c5f4a603db526d335ba3a886404 OP_EQUAL
address
3JDU8TLFy2h8c4UQfH2RyF7jzLG4g4MSmp
transaction
87e343030cfe7dc083e73ef80c2b1e44a33befccbcc4a124e1fd789fc119f459
confirmations
201144
spent
true